About This Charity
The Rotary Club of Southgate was chartered in 1925 and currently has a membership of 17 men and women who meet for lunch every Monday at 12.45pm in a private room at the Jolly Farmers, Enfield Road, Enfield, Middlesex, which is in Greater London, England or on Zoom at 7.30pm. (1st and 3rd Mondays are Evening Zoom meetings and 2nd and 4th Mondays are face to face meetings at The Jolly Farmers).
